If you’ve previously struggled with social norms about weight and body-image, a fat-positive / body-positive therapist can help. The Fat Acceptance Movement, founded on body positivity, inspires others to accept and even celebrate their fatness. However, seeing others love themselves is not always enough.
It could take help from a licensed, professional body-positive therapist to help you improve your self-esteem and empower you to fully embrace and love your body just as it is. Most therapists are equipped to help you sort through common problems like depression, anxiety, and PTSD. But when you’re fat, there’s a possible element of shame and social anxiety that can take over and affect your therapy experience.
